About us

New House was started by Harold Stanier as a clever and innovative textile business back in 1921. Today it's still owned by the same family who continue the tradition by creating and designing high quality textile products, notably fabrics for roller blinds, blind accessories, haberdashery, braids & trimmings and kitchen homeware products.

Whilst based in rural Herefordshire, New House has exported products all round the world and our philosophy is to combine British creativity, flair, craftsmanship and innovation under the one roof.

New House operates from 300yr old buildings, deep in rural Herefordshire and close to a bend in the River Wye.

Where we make things

We get as many items made as locally as possible, such as our painted items that are carefully made a few miles away in Ledbury, or our braids and trimmings in Derbyshire (below). Our fabrics are usually printed in the UK, but many of our fabrics are created in a specialist mill in Sweden who we've worked with for over 30 years. We also use a careful weaver in Japan who is skilled at combining the latest technology with old traditional ways of textile production.

Our textile machinery

New House also makes textile machinery and has been designing and producing yarn breakage detectors for the textile industry for over 70 years.
